FTP(File Transfer Protocol,文件传输协议)是一种用于在网络上进行文件传输的标准协议。利用FTP,我们可以方便地将文件从一个地方传输到另一个地方。对于需要频繁进行文件上传和下载的用户来说,掌握FTP批处理命令将大大提高工作效率。本文将详细介绍如何使用FTP批处理命令实现文件的批量上传和下载。
一、FTP批处理命令简介
FTP批处理命令是指通过编写一个批处理文件(以.bat为扩展名)来执行FTP命令,从而实现文件的上传和下载。批处理文件可以包含多个FTP命令,执行时依次执行这些命令。
二、编写FTP批处理文件
- 打开记事本:点击“开始”菜单,输入“记事本”,选择“记事本”程序打开。
- 编写FTP命令:
open ftp服务器地址:连接到FTP服务器。user 用户名 密码:登录FTP服务器。binary:设置传输模式为二进制,适用于上传和下载图片、音频、视频等文件。get 文件名:下载指定文件。put 文件名:上传指定文件。bye:退出FTP连接。
- 保存批处理文件:点击“文件”菜单,选择“另存为”,将文件命名为“ftp_up.bat”或“ftp_down.bat”,保存类型为“所有文件”,保存位置选择合适的位置。
三、示例:批量上传文件
以下是一个简单的FTP批处理文件示例,用于将本地文件夹中的所有文件上传到FTP服务器:
@echo off
cd /d D:\local_folder
open ftp服务器地址
user 用户名 密码
binary
put *
bye
其中,D:\local_folder 是本地文件夹路径,需要根据实际情况进行修改。ftp服务器地址、用户名 和 密码 也需要替换为相应的信息。
四、示例:批量下载文件
以下是一个简单的FTP批处理文件示例,用于将FTP服务器上的所有文件下载到本地文件夹:
@echo off
cd /d D:\local_folder
open ftp服务器地址
user 用户名 密码
binary
get *
bye
同样地,需要将本地文件夹路径、ftp服务器地址、用户名 和 密码 替换为相应的信息。
五、总结
通过编写FTP批处理命令,我们可以轻松实现文件的批量上传和下载。掌握FTP批处理命令,将大大提高文件传输的效率。在实际应用中,可以根据需要调整批处理文件中的命令,以满足不同的需求。
